HIGHLY CONFIDENTIAL Summary of Transaction Panda Investment Management, LLC will acquire all outstanding Class A shares of Panda Investment Transaction Management, Inc. by way of a merger of a newly formed subsidiary of Panda Investment Management, LLC with Structure Panda Investment Management, Inc. Merger Consideration for $9.60 per share of Class A common stock Class A Shares Implied Transaction Equity Value $168mm (at $9.60 / Class A common stock)1 [To update per merger agreement] $200mm of total debt commitments for a senior secured term loan facility â–ª Lead Arranger / Agent: JPMorgan Chase Bank, N.A. Financing â–ª Maturity: five years from the closing date â–ª Pricing: SOFR + 0.10% credit spread adjustment + 2.50% drawn pricing (subject to change based on leverage-based grid) “No-shop” / non-solicitation with ability to consider unsolicited, potentially superior proposals Other Provisions Reverse termination fee: If the merger agreement is terminated due to certain conditions, Panda Investment Management, LLC is subject to pay a reverse termination fee (subject to negotiation), to the Class A shareholders as a special dividend Source: Merger Agreement and Senior Credit Facility Commitment Letter. 1 [Based on diluted Class A shares outstanding as of 30-June-2022, per Panda management, consisting of approximately 16.8M of Class July 2022 2 A shares, 689K of phantom Class A units, 50K of 2017 Class A unit options and 190K of delayed Class A options (note: options dilution calculated using treasury stock method).]

HIGHLY CONFIDENTIAL S e l e c t e d Tr a d i t i o n a l A s s e t M a n a g e m e n t C h a n g e o f C o n t r o l Tr a n s a c t i o n s F o o t n o t e s 1 Metrics sourced from Merger Agreement and Q1 10Q 2022. Purchase price calculated as per share merger consideration of $12.85 multiplied by diluted shares outstanding. Implied multiple calculated as EV divided by LTM Q1 2022A EBITDA. EV calculated as purchase price less cash and cash equivalents and investment securities. LTM EBITDA calculated as LTM Q1 2022A operating income plus D&A. Target AUM as of 31-Mar-2022. 2 Per BrightSphere’s press release, Pendal Group acquired a 75.1% of ownership interest in Thompson, Siegel Walmsley (“TSW”) from BrightSphere (for $240M) and 24.9% from TSW management for a total consideration of ~$320M. In addition to acquiring BrightSphere’s equity interest in TSW, Pendal also agreed to acquire BrightSphere’s seed capital in TSW strategies post-close for approximately $14M. Purchase price shown excludes the purchase of seed investments. Implied multiple of 7.6x 1H2021A (annualized and excluding synergies) per Pendal Group’s investor presentation. Target AUM as of 31-Mar-2021. 3 Per Macquarie’s investor presentation: total headline consideration of ~$1.7B, headline acquisition multiple of ~10x EV/EBITDA and pro forma multiple of ~6x EV/EBITDA post sell down of balance sheet assets, before the sale of the wealth management business and realization of synergies. Macquarie intended to acquire all of the outstanding common shares of Waddell & Reed and, on completion, sell Waddell & Reed’s wealth management platform to LPL for $300M plus excess net assets. $131B of target AUM includes asset management AUM of ~$68B and wealth management AUA of ~$63B as of 30-Sep-2020. 4 Per BrightSphere’s press release, BrightSphere has agreed to sell its 75.1% ownership interest in Barrow Hanley to Perpetual Limited for $319M. In addition, Perpetual will redeem BrightSphere’s seed capital investments in Barrow Hanley at closing, which had a market value of ~$44M as of 30-Jun-2020. Purchase price shown calculated as $319M (75.1%) grossed up to 100% and does not include the $44M of redemption of seed capital. BrightSphere reported 1H CY2020A EBITDA attributable to controlling interest of $20M. Implied multiple per Perpetual press release. Target AUM as of 30-Jun-2020. 5 Purchase price represents $850M upfront payment. (Note: there are contingent payments of up to $150M over four years based on future business performance.) EBITDA multiple of 6.9x (upfront purchase price excluding expected synergies and tax benefit), 3.8x (upfront purchase price including expected synergies) and 3.2x (upfront purchase price including expected synergies and tax benefit) per Victory Capital’s investor presentation. Target AUM as of 30-Sep-2018. 6 Per Federated Investors’ press release, Federated Investors will pay ~$350M for a 60% interest in Hermes Investment Management. Purchase price shown of $0.6B represents $350M grossed-up to 100%. Per Federated Investors’ investor presentation, EV / EBITDA of 12.8x corresponds to 2017 Hermes standalone EBITDA (post-minority interests). Target AUM as of 31-Dec-2017. Target AUM of $45B represents Ł33B adjusted by GBP USD spot FX conversion rate of 1.35 as of 31-Dec-2017 per investor presentation. Source: Company filings. July 2022 24
